Title of article :
Continuous aerosol size spectrometry with a variable-orifice impactor

Abstract :
An aerosol size spectrometer based on a round-jet impactor of continuously variable geometry is tested using an iris diaphragm as the nozzle. The impactor is run by fixing the nozzle-to-plate distance L, the aerosol mass flow rate m′, and the volumetric pumping capacity Q, which results in a nearly fixed downstream pressure at variable nozzle diameter dn. Tests are carried below 1.3 and 2.5 mm. The size spectrometer has an excellent resolution when the jet Reynolds number and nozzle-to-plate distance are kept within the ranges 175 Re 700; 0.75 L/dn 3.33. The instrument may also be run at atmospheric pressure, with an estimated lower size range of 1.7 μm.
